Configuring Variables

7.7.5

Naming I/O Points Automatically

You can choose to have AutoMax Executive V3.x assign variable

names and descriptions for one or more selected I/O points. Variable

names will be assigned as follows.
All names will begin with the character string (up to 4 characters) you

designate as the prefix. The remaining characters will be digits, and

will follow one of the formats below.
Key to abbreviations found in the formats below:
m=master slot (for remote I/O)
s= slot
p= port (Remote Rail I/O head)
l= local port (Remote Rail I/O head)
d= drop
R =AutoMate register prefix (RĆNet Network Interface)
r= register number (user register; field will consist of only the

number of digits needed to define the field.)

b= bit number (for boolean variables only)
f= AllenĆBradley file letter
n= network letter
D Digital I/O, analog I/O, DCS drive modules, Resolver, Pulsetach,

AĆB RIO Scanner, motion control

Local: ssr..rbb

Remote: mmdssr..rbb

D Universal Drive Controller

Local: ssr...rbb

Remote: N/A

D Network

Setup and Status registers: ssr..rbb

Broadcast: nr..r

Registers in Drop Areas: nddr..r

Remote: N/A

D Common Memory

Local: N/A

Remote: N/A

D RĆNet Network Interface

Local: ssRr...rbb

Remote: N/A

D Gateway (Modbus, AutoMate, Toledo Scale)

Local: ssr...rbb

Remote: N/A

D Gateway (AllenĆBradley)

Local: ssfr...rbb

Remote: N/A

D Digital Rail, TWS, LED

Local: N/A

Remote: mmdplbb
